What are Chakras?
Chakras are spinning wheels or vortexes of energy that exist within our subtle body. They are thought to be adjoined with our physical, psychological, and psychological well-being. There are 7 main chakras aligned along the spinal column, each She Hei Ki related to specific organs, feelings, and elements of life.
Root Chakra: Structure and Stability
The Root Chakra, likewise referred to as Muladhara, lies at the base of the spinal column. It represents our structure and offers a sense of stability and security. When this chakra is balanced, we feel grounded and linked to the earth.
Sacral Chakra: Imagination and Sensuality
The Sacral Chakra, referred to as Svadhisthana, is positioned simply listed below the navel. It governs our creativity, sensuality, and psychological wellness. When this chakra agrees, we experience a healthy circulation of energy in our relationships and imaginative endeavors.
Solar Plexus Chakra: Personal Power
The Solar Plexus Chakra, Manipura in Sanskrit, is located above the navel. It relates to our individual power and self-confidence. When this chakra is well balanced, we feel confident and empowered to take on challenges.
Heart Chakra: Love and Compassion
The Heart Chakra, Anahata in Sanskrit, lives in the center of the chest. It is related to love, empathy, and emotional recovery. When this chakra is open, we are able to provide and receive love freely.
Throat Chakra: Interaction and Expression
The Throat Chakra, Vishuddha in Sanskrit, is positioned at the base of the throat. It governs our ability to interact and reveal ourselves authentically. When this chakra is well balanced, we speak our truth with clarity and confidence.
Third Eye Chakra: Intuition and Insight
The Third Eye Chakra, Ajna in Sanskrit, lies in between the eyebrows. It represents our instinct, insight, and inner wisdom. When this chakra is open, we have actually a heightened sense of perception and Mastering Sei Hei Ki clarity.
Crown Chakra: Spiritual Connection
The Crown Chakra, Sahasrara in Sanskrit, is located at the top of the head. It links us to greater consciousness and spirituality. When this chakra is well balanced, we experience a deep sense of peace and spiritual connection.

Dai Ko Myo: This symbol represents knowledge and spiritual connection. It can be used to trigger and stabilize the crown chakra.A Quick History of Reiki
Reiki was established by Mikao Usui, a Japanese Buddhist monk, in the early 20th century. Usui found this healing strategy throughout a spiritual retreat on Mount Kurama in Japan. Ever since, Reiki has spread around the world, progressing into numerous branches and interpretations.

The Reiki Attunement Process
In order to practice Reiki, individuals should go through a process called attunement. During an attunement, a Reiki Master transfers the ability to transport Reiki energy to the trainee. This procedure opens the student's energetic pathways and enables them to connect with universal life force energy.
